## Tuning bulk edits

Bulk edits in the Ledgerpane admin table are applied in batches to avoid lock contention on the records service. Batch size, inter-batch delay, and the per-request row ceiling were chosen after the Q3 load tests; changing any one of them affects the others, so please adjust together and re-run the soak suite. The current values are as follows.

tuning table, yajog-yahof:
BUDGETS = {
    "lamvan": 303,
    "wenox": 460,
    "fenvan": 525,
}

Subject: Winding down the Cobaltine line

Hi all,

Quick heads-up for finance: we're officially retiring the Cobaltine accessories line at the end of Q3. Sales have been sliding for six quarters, and Marla's team confirmed the tooling refresh isn't worth it. Expect a small write-down on remaining inventory plus warranty reserves through next year. Full numbers at Thursday's review. One more thing before the details land below.

board note of tawip-hahip: Only 7 of the 80 pilot accounts renewed Ralath, so a churn review is set for April 1.

# Break-Glass Access — Fixturefox

Hey future maintainers. Fixturefox is our test-data factory library, and normally you never need production-adjacent access for it. But if the seed registry gets corrupted and CI goes red across the board, there's a break-glass path: it restores the canonical factory snapshots that every suite depends on. Use it sparingly — it bypasses the usual review gates and pages the on-call. When you genuinely need it, the break-glass restore accepts the passphrase listed directly below.

vault phrase of bagaf-kajeg = jorath-feniel-briir-siliel-ralix

Minutes — Management Meeting, Thornby Office

Attendees: Pell, Marisk, Odenne. We confirmed the Glintware kettle line retires end of Q3. Remaining stock shifts to outlet branches; no reorders after August. Marisk will draft customer messaging. Warranty support continues eighteen months. Branch managers should brief floor staff quietly for now, since the rationale is covered in the confidential note below.

confidential, kagep-kahof: Druokax Systems plans to lower the Ulaath list price by 53 percent in March.